
GREATeclectic, artist, DJ & editor of the infamous Art & Culture magazine Art Nouveau, will unleash his debut album January 31, 2012. He is giving us the first taste with “#1 Fan,” a roaring dance anthem featuring singer Antonio Stapleton & Canadian based rapper KJ. In the past two years, GREATeclectic has opened up for J*DaVeY, Theophilus London, Taz Arnold in addition to planning events in Atlanta & Miami with the likes of VA$HTIE & Dee & Ricky. From these experiences, he has made an album that touches on the sonic stepping stones he’s used year by year to pave his way to the present. Spencer Greene aka Savvy Society is a New Jersey born, Atlanta based Producer/DJ who I’ve been familiar with for sometime now. In all actuality, he’s like my little brother from another mother. The self-described ‘anti-hipster’ grew up on house and club music, so it’s no wonder that his sound is sexy a mix of jazzy synths that would make Pharrell coo and banging beats that evoke the tribal thump of both Africa and the fidget bass of Baltimore club music.
